During Trooping the Colour, Princess Charlotte donned a navy and cream sailor’s dress, echoing an outfit worn by her mother, Kate. The tradition of royal children wearing sailor’s suits dates back to Queen Victoria, who had a child-sized naval outfit made for her son, Prince Edward. The attire was met with cheers and admiration when the young prince appeared in it, sparking a trend that has endured through generations of royal children.
